Exponential sums related to Maass forms

2019

We estimate short exponential sums weighted by the Fourier coefficients of a Maass form. This requires working out a certain transformation formula for non-linear exponential sums, which is of independent interest. We also discuss how the results depend on the growth of the Fourier coefficients in question. As a byproduct of these considerations, we can slightly extend the range of validity of a short exponential sum estimate for holomorphic cusp forms. The short estimates allow us to reduce smoothing errors. In particular, we prove an analogue of an approximate functional equation previously proven for holomorphic cusp form coefficients. Generalized Henstock integrals in the theory of series in multiplicative systems

2004

Properties of a Henstock type integral defined by means of a differential basis generated by P-adic paths ae studied. It is proved that this integral solves the problem of coefficients reconstruction by using generalized Fourier formulas for a series over multiplivative systems.

Comparison of the P-integral with Burkill's integrals and some applications to trigonometric series

2023

It is proved that the $P_r$-integral [9] which recovers a function from its derivative defined in the space $L^r$, 1 ≤r<∞, is properly included in Burkill’s trigonometric CP-and SCP-integrals. As an application to harmonic analysis, a de La Vallée-Poussin-type theorem for the $P_r$-integral is obtained: convergence nearly everywhere of a trigonometric series to a $P_r$-integrable function f implies that this series is the Pr-Fourier series of f.
